Home
last modified time | relevance | path

Searched refs:captureListener (Results 1 – 13 of 13) sorted by relevance

/aosp12/frameworks/native/services/surfaceflinger/tests/utils/
H A DScreenshotUtils.h38 const sp<SyncScreenCaptureListener> captureListener = new SyncScreenCaptureListener(); in captureDisplay() local
39 status_t status = sf->captureDisplay(captureArgs, captureListener); in captureDisplay()
44 captureResults = captureListener->waitForResults(); in captureDisplay()
71 const sp<SyncScreenCaptureListener> captureListener = new SyncScreenCaptureListener(); in captureLayers() local
72 status_t status = sf->captureLayers(captureArgs, captureListener); in captureLayers()
76 captureResults = captureListener->waitForResults(); in captureLayers()
/aosp12/frameworks/base/cmds/screencap/
H A Dscreencap.cpp184 sp<SyncScreenCaptureListener> captureListener = new SyncScreenCaptureListener(); in main() local
185 status_t result = ScreenshotClient::captureDisplay(displayId->value, captureListener); in main()
191 ScreenCaptureResults captureResults = captureListener->waitForResults(); in main()
/aosp12/frameworks/native/libs/gui/include/gui/
H A DISurfaceComposer.h245 const sp<IScreenCaptureListener>& captureListener) = 0;
248 const sp<IScreenCaptureListener>& captureListener) = 0;
261 const sp<IScreenCaptureListener>& captureListener) = 0;
H A DSurfaceComposerClient.h646 const sp<IScreenCaptureListener>& captureListener);
648 const sp<IScreenCaptureListener>& captureListener);
650 const sp<IScreenCaptureListener>& captureListener);
/aosp12/frameworks/native/libs/gui/
H A DISurfaceComposer.cpp122 SAFE_PARCEL(data.writeStrongBinder, IInterface::asBinder(captureListener)); in captureDisplay()
132 SAFE_PARCEL(data.writeStrongBinder, IInterface::asBinder(captureListener)); in captureDisplay()
1350 sp<IScreenCaptureListener> captureListener; in onTransact() local
1352 SAFE_PARCEL(data.readStrongBinder, &captureListener); in onTransact()
1354 return captureDisplay(args, captureListener); in onTransact()
1359 sp<IScreenCaptureListener> captureListener; in onTransact() local
1361 SAFE_PARCEL(data.readStrongBinder, &captureListener); in onTransact()
1363 return captureDisplay(displayOrLayerStack, captureListener); in onTransact()
1368 sp<IScreenCaptureListener> captureListener; in onTransact() local
1370 SAFE_PARCEL(data.readStrongBinder, &captureListener); in onTransact()
[all …]
H A DSurfaceComposerClient.cpp2212 const sp<IScreenCaptureListener>& captureListener) { in captureDisplay() argument
2216 return s->captureDisplay(captureArgs, captureListener); in captureDisplay()
2220 const sp<IScreenCaptureListener>& captureListener) { in captureDisplay() argument
2224 return s->captureDisplay(displayOrLayerStack, captureListener); in captureDisplay()
2228 const sp<IScreenCaptureListener>& captureListener) { in captureLayers() argument
2232 return s->captureLayers(captureArgs, captureListener); in captureLayers()
/aosp12/frameworks/native/services/surfaceflinger/
H A DRegionSamplingThread.cpp359 const sp<SyncScreenCaptureListener> captureListener = new SyncScreenCaptureListener(); in captureSample() local
361 true /* regionSampling */, false /* grayscale */, captureListener); in captureSample()
362 ScreenCaptureResults captureResults = captureListener->waitForResults(); in captureSample()
H A DSurfaceFlinger.cpp6067 const sp<IScreenCaptureListener>& captureListener) { in captureDisplay() argument
6115 captureListener); in captureDisplay()
6159 false /* grayscale */, captureListener); in captureDisplay()
6163 const sp<IScreenCaptureListener>& captureListener) { in captureLayers() argument
6279 captureListener); in captureLayers()
6330 false /* regionSampling */, grayscale, captureListener); in captureScreenCommon()
6336 bool grayscale, const sp<IScreenCaptureListener>& captureListener) { in captureScreenCommon() argument
6339 if (captureListener == nullptr) { in captureScreenCommon()
6350 grayscale, captureListener); in captureScreenCommon()
6358 captureListener->onScreenCaptureCompleted(captureResults); in captureScreenCommon()
[all …]
H A DSurfaceFlinger.h635 const sp<IScreenCaptureListener>& captureListener) override;
637 const sp<IScreenCaptureListener>& captureListener) override;
639 const sp<IScreenCaptureListener>& captureListener) override;
/aosp12/frameworks/base/core/java/android/view/
H A DSurfaceControl.java102 ScreenCaptureListener captureListener); in nativeCaptureDisplay() argument
104 ScreenCaptureListener captureListener); in nativeCaptureLayers() argument
2391 @NonNull ScreenCaptureListener captureListener) { in captureDisplay() argument
2392 return nativeCaptureDisplay(captureArgs, captureListener); in captureDisplay()
2494 @NonNull ScreenCaptureListener captureListener) { in captureLayers() argument
2495 return nativeCaptureLayers(captureArgs, captureListener); in captureLayers()
/aosp12/frameworks/native/libs/gui/tests/
H A DBLASTBufferQueue_test.cpp268 const sp<SyncScreenCaptureListener> captureListener = new SyncScreenCaptureListener(); in captureDisplay() local
269 status_t status = sf->captureDisplay(captureArgs, captureListener); in captureDisplay()
273 captureResults = captureListener->waitForResults(); in captureDisplay()
H A DSurface_test.cpp206 const sp<SyncScreenCaptureListener> captureListener = new SyncScreenCaptureListener(); in captureDisplay() local
207 status_t status = sf->captureDisplay(captureArgs, captureListener); in captureDisplay()
211 captureResults = captureListener->waitForResults(); in captureDisplay()
/aosp12/frameworks/base/core/jni/
H A Dandroid_view_SurfaceControl.cpp462 sp<IScreenCaptureListener> captureListener = in nativeCaptureDisplay() local
464 return ScreenshotClient::captureDisplay(captureArgs, captureListener); in nativeCaptureDisplay()
498 sp<IScreenCaptureListener> captureListener = in nativeCaptureLayers() local
500 return ScreenshotClient::captureLayers(captureArgs, captureListener); in nativeCaptureLayers()